The office of trustee is honorary, without salary or other compensation.

A board of law library trustees may remove any trustee, except an ex officio trustee, who is absent from three consecutive meetings of the board, and may fill all vacancies that from any cause occur in the board.

Each board shall appoint one of its number as president.

The board of supervisors may appropriate from the county treasury for law library purposes such sums as may in their discretion appear proper. When so paid into the law library fund, those sums shall constitute a part of the fund and be used for the same purposes.

A board may purchase books, journals, other publications, and other personal property. It may dispose of obsolete or duplicate books, and other unneeded or unusable property.

A board shall fix the salaries of the law librarian and law library employees, and may require a bond of any law librarian or law library employee, in such sum as it may fix. The premium on a bond given by an authorized surety company may be paid from the law library fund.

A board of law library trustees may contract with the California Public Employees’ Retirement System, to make all or any of the employees of the law library members of the system.

Real property acquired by a board may be sold, leased, rented, or licensed with the proceeds to be deposited in the law library fund.

A financial report, showing all receipts and disbursements of money, shall be made by the secretary, duly verified by oath, at the same time that the report of the board is made.

The State Librarian shall periodically supply to each law library established under the provisions of this chapter, and requesting the same, information regarding newly published materials to aid such libraries in their selection of new materials.
